I will play Devil's Advocate however. The bases currently in minefields are some of the oldest POB's in the game, meaning they have had their purpose and locations RP'd by long standing members in this Community. Not wanting to destroy or severely alter this RP, the Admins decided to allow existing POBs to be grandfathered in when the current 15k rule was established.

I support the rule change, for the sake of improved gameplay, however it would be wise to consider what effects said change would have on members who may be forced to have their POB's moved. Maybe some sort of compensation to soften the blow might be warranted?

(10-25-2016, 07:54 PM)Garrett Jax Wrote: I will play Devil's Advocate however. [...] Maybe some sort of compensation to soften the blow might be warranted?

It would send a badly screwed up message to all those who have done the right thing years earlier and moved their bases voluntarily after it became clear that they are damaging gameplay. If I was the owner of Puerto (the Sair blocking base that relocated a few months ago), I would be cursing if this ever happened and those that just did not move were rewarded now.

In my opinion, it is impossible to reward those few remaining detrimental POBs, as it would create an entirely paradox situation of rewarding those who in reality deserve it the least.

Again, playing Devil's Advocate...

Jack, you imply wrongdoing where none exists. I know you requested to have your own base moved because you felt it was harming gameplay, and that was noble, because you considered the greater good. It doesn't mean that other players, who were well within the rules, are doing the wrong thing by not voluntarily moving their bases.

I understand your point about incurring anger over a lack of reward for those who have moved their bases voluntarily, but I can't recall any particular request from a Community member to have their base moved, that didn't receive at least the 'reward' of being able to upgrade their Core, given that they were now out of a mineable field.. However, it's been awhile since I served, and I'm not privy to the particulars of each individual base. My empathy for base owners is simply kicking in here and I'd hate to lose out on valued members of the Community with this rule change.

Antonio already did a good job of dissecting this post, but I thought I should respond as well.

First of all, the problem with bases in mining fields is not that they are easily used as mining storage. The problem is that they allow ships mining within them to dock and escape pirates very easily, and since they're "traders", they can just log back in later and start again, once their counter-metagaming tools tell them that it's safe. By pushing the mining bases outside the fields, it allows for at least some amount of competition, and keeps stuff like defense platforms outside the mining field (in the case of non-existent competitive mining fields).

Thus, stuff like Beaumont, Danzig, and Falster aren't even a problem, because you'll find it very difficult to find anyone sitting in the scrap field waiting to be pirated. I'll also remind you that Beaumont Spire was originally built on top of Beaumont Base (hence the name), but was then moved because of a wackjob conspiracy theory that the JM would "take over the base" and shoot Congress ships.
